How the Zombie Score Assessment Works
The Zombie Score measures three tensions every human navigates — not to judge you, but to show you where your energy goes and whether you chose that shape on purpose.
Presence ↔ Pace
Are you here, fully in the moment? Or are you building something that matters and the momentum is hard to pause? Both are valid. The question is your ratio.
Balcony ↔ Dance Floor
Can you see the system from above — the patterns, the waste, the pressure points? Or are you in it, feeling the music, reading the room? Both perspectives matter.
Margin ↔ Momentum
Do you have space for surprise and experimentation? Or have you built an engine that compounds through consistency? The garden vs. the treadmill when it works.

My daughter called me a zombie.

Not the brain-eating kind. The other kind — the one who's physically in the room but mentally somewhere else. The one who says “uh-huh” while scrolling. The one who's there but not there.
That word broke something open. Not because I was doing anything wrong — but because the right things can make you a zombie too. The treadmill exists for all of us. Whatever your situation, the pattern is the same: you start running for good reasons, and somewhere along the way the running becomes the reason.
This assessment is the mirror that came out of that moment. It won't tell you you're doing it wrong. It will show you the shape of your life right now — and ask whether that shape is the one you'd choose on purpose.

Is the Zombie Score a personality test?+
No. A personality test tells you who you are and implies it is fixed. The Zombie Score describes how you are living right now — a snapshot of this season, not a permanent type. Your pattern is expected to change as your circumstances change, which is why the assessment is built to be retaken.
